Forgotten is an Easy Linux machine from VulnLab, recently added to Hackthebox. It involves exploiting an incomplete LimeSurvey installation to gain admin access (RCE) and then using a shared folder between the container and the host to transfer a bash script and escalate to root.

Accessing the /survey directory exposed a partially completed LimeSurvey installation, indicating setup steps were incomplete and left the instance in a misconfigured state.

LimeSurvey

Exploitation

The LimeSurvey installer requires a MySQL database, so we must run a local MySQL service before proceeding with the installation.

1
sudo docker run --name some-mysql -e MYSQL_ROOT_PASSWORD=root -p 3306:3306 -d mysql:latest

Installed

Once the LimeSurvey installation is finished, we can access the admin interface by authenticating with the credentials defined during the setup process.

Admin

Upon logging in, the admin interface indicates LimeSurvey 6.3.7+231127 is running. Public advisories report that this version is susceptible to an authenticated remote code execution (RCE) vulnerability. The steps are quite simple:

  1. Create archive with these files
  2. Login with credentials
  3. Go Configuration -> Plugins -> Upload & Install
  4. Choose your zipped file
  5. Upload & Install
  6. Pivoting.
  7. Start your listener
  8. Go url+{upload/plugins/#Name/#Shell_file_name}

Editing the config.xml file to include the 6.0 version and the php-rev.php to connect to our attacker machine, we are able to zip it and send it to the webserver.

Installed

Once the file was uploaded, we accessed the resource at the GitHub‑specified path — either via a browser or by sending an HTTP request from the terminal (curl) — to trigger and observe its behavior.

1
curl http://10.129.234.81/survey/upload/plugins/Y1LD1R1M/php-rev.php

With the netcat listener on the background, we get a response from the webserver.

Privilege Escalation

We had root on the container but lacked host-level privileges. Enumeration revealed a directory mounted into both the container and the host. By placing a privileged shell binary into that shared directory, we were able to escalate privileges and obtain root on the host. On the container we run:

1
2
root@efaa6f5097ed:/var/www/html/survey# cp /bin/bash .
root@efaa6f5097ed:/var/www/html/survey# chmod 6777 bash

On the host:

1
2
3
4
5
limesvc@forgotten:/opt/limesurvey$ id
uid=2000(limesvc) gid=2000(limesvc) groups=2000(limesvc)
limesvc@forgotten:/opt/limesurvey$ ./bash -p
bash-5.1# id
uid=2000(limesvc) gid=2000(limesvc) euid=0(root) egid=0(root) groups=0(root),2000(limesvc)
